Output 7648416c4eac74b384dc0f88aa8394e80bf1f1c721b8632eca011f739f253424:7

value
153496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f921109d8b95af1de14734450da734fab639b3c3 OP_EQUAL
address
3QQHnhWoTv2oZSheYaZypDJ8fU3egMxKyW
transaction
7648416c4eac74b384dc0f88aa8394e80bf1f1c721b8632eca011f739f253424
spent
true